    Expert description

    El Dorado 25 Year Guyana 1990 is a Guyana Rum matured in ex-bourbon casks and bottled at 43%.

    The rum was created to mark the turn of the millennium and comes from Demerara Distillers in Guyana, which distils on a collection of historic stills, including the Port Mourant pot still, the Enmore wooden coffey still and the Versailles pot still. After distillation, the rum is matured for at least 25 years in casks that previously held bourbon, giving it, over the years, a silky-smooth structure many compare to old cognac.

    Tasting notes

    Nose

    Dark caramel, molasses, baking spice and tobacco, underpinned by a deep, rounded oak tone.

    Palate

    Sweet and syrupy with brown sugar, cloves, nutmeg, raisins, dates and a hint of cigar tobacco.

    Finish

    Long, soft and mellow, where the oak and the syrupy sweetness carry all the way through.

    Did you know?

    El Dorado 25 Year was originally launched to mark the turn of the millennium, and the name El Dorado refers to the myth of the golden city Spanish explorers pursued in the very area where the Demerara River flows today.
